Here are some of the EXCITING things you'll get to do:
  • Take ownership of packaging supplier strategy across key categories (corrugate, gift box, molded pulp, labels, manuals, flexible materials, foams, and other protective packaging), ensuring cost, quality, capacity, and sustainability performance.
  • Build, maintain, and govern packaging AVLs by identifying, qualifying, onboarding, and developing suppliers that align to SharkNinja product, regional, and compliance requirements.
  • Partner with Packaging Engineering, Quality, Sustainability, and Regulatory teams to scout, assess, and commercialize compliant material opportunities, including recycled content, paper-based alternatives, mono-material, and plastic-reduction solutions.
  • Develop should-cost and total-cost models for packaging that include material conversion, tooling, freight, duties, EPR schemes, packaging taxes, eco-modulated fees, and other regulatory cost exposure.
  • Lead RFQs, supplier negotiations, and cost-down initiatives to deliver the best balance of cost, performance, compliance, and speed to market.
  • Monitor supplier capabilities, market trends, and packaging regulations; recommend new sources, technology options, and risk mitigation plans to strengthen supply security and sustainability performance.
  • Maintain packaging cost trackers, AVL records, supplier scorecards, and executive-ready summaries, while operating with a multi-cultural working style across China and global teams.

You are Expected:
  • 6-8+ years of experience in packaging sourcing, procurement, supply chain, or packaging engineering within home appliances, consumer goods, or a related industry, ideally in multinational environments
  • Strong knowledge of packaging materials, converting processes, tooling, and cost drivers across paper, plastic, molded fiber, labels, inserts, and protective packaging
  • Hands-on experience building and managing AVLs, supplier qualification, supplier development, and commercial negotiations
  • Familiarity with packaging sustainability requirements and regional regulations, including EPR, packaging taxes/fees, recyclability, recycled content, and restricted-substance compliance
  • Strong analytical skills, with the ability to build should-cost and total-cost models and translate regulatory impacts into sourcing recommendations
  • Proficient in English and Mandarin (verbal and written), able to independently manage communication with both Chinese and international suppliers
  • Self-motivated and independent, with strong stakeholder management, communication, and project management skills
  • Strong execution, negotiation, persuasion, and cross-functional collaboration skills
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office, data analysis, and project management tools; ERP/PLM experience is a plus

Education/Certifications/Affiliations
  • Bachelor's degree (or above) in Packaging Engineering, Materials Science, Supply Chain, Business, or a related discipline preferred
  • MBA, CPSM, packaging-related certification, or sustainability/compliance training is an advantage

Travel Requirements
  • Regular travel across East and South China (Guangdong, Zhejiang, Jiangsu, etc.) and periodic travel across Southeast Asia to support supplier qualification, audits, and development
